Linking North Atlantic Oscillation and greenhouse gases
http://www.agu.org/news/press/jhighlight_archives/2005/jh050323.html#2

Kuzmina et al., AGU


An analysis using a dozen climate models suggests that the North Atlantic Oscillation (NAO) may intensify with further increases to greenhouse gas concentrations.
